The Importance of a Driver's Permit

A driver's authorization, likewise referred to as a student's authorization, is a legal document that permits an individual to operate an automobile under the supervision of a certified driver. It is an essential stepping stone in the journey to becoming a fully certified driver. Holding a permit not just helps you practice and improve your driving skills however also ensures that you are familiar with traffic laws and road safety guidelines before you take the last driving test.

Actions to Obtain a Driver's Permit

  1. Determine Eligibility

    • Usually, people should be at least 15 or 16 years old to look for a learner's authorization, though the age requirement differs by state.
    • You need to have a legitimate Social Security Number (SSN) or a Taxpayer Identification Number (TIN).
    • Proof of residency and identity, such as a birth certificate or passport, is required.
  2. Study the Driver's Handbook

    • Each state offers a driver's handbook, which contains essential info about traffic laws, roadway indications, and safe driving practices.
    • Acquaint yourself with the content, as it will be the basis for the composed authorization test.
  3. Take the Written Permit Test

  4. Pass the Vision Test

    • A vision test is needed to ensure that you satisfy the minimum vision standards for driving.
    • If you wear glasses or contact lenses, bring them to the test.
  5. Send Required Documents

    • Bring all necessary documents, consisting of evidence of identity, residency, and SSN or TIN.
    • Some states might likewise require evidence of school enrollment or conclusion of a driver's education course.
  6. Pay the Permit Fee

    • The charge for a driver's authorization varies by state but normally ranges from ₤ 10 to ₤ 50.
    • Payment can normally be made by cash, check, or credit card.
  7. Get Your Permit

    • If you pass the written and vision tests and offer all required documentation, you will be provided a driver's license.
    • Some states may send by mail the license to your address, while others will offer it on the area.

Requirements for Holding a Driver's Permit

  • Monitored Driving: You should constantly be accompanied by a licensed driver who is at least 21 years old (age requirements might differ by state).
  • Practice Hours: Most states require a minimum variety of monitored driving hours, typically varying from 40 to 50 hours, including 10 hours of night driving.
  • Age Restrictions: There may be specific age requirements for when you can upgrade to a complete driver's license.
  • Curfew Laws: Some states have curfew laws for license holders, restricting driving throughout late-night hours.
  • No Alcohol: You need to not take in any alcohol before or during driving.

Tips for Successful Permit Test Preparation

  • Use Online Resources: Many states provide online practice tests and research study products.
  • Take Practice Tests: Familiarize yourself with the test format and kinds of questions by taking practice tests.
  • Understand Road Signs: Be able to recognize and understand the meaning of typical road signs and signals.
  • Know Traffic Laws: Study the specific traffic laws and policies of your state.
  • Stay Calm: Test stress and anxiety can impact performance, so take deep breaths and stay calm during the test.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s)

Q: What is the minimum age to request a driver's license?

  • A: The minimum age to look for a driver's permit varies by state however is generally in between 15 and 16 years of ages.

Q: Can I take the written authorization test online?

  • A: Some states use the choice to take the composed permit test online, while others require you to take it in individual at a DMV office. Check your state's DMV website for specific information.

Q: What documents do I require to bring to the DMV?

  • A: You will require to bring evidence of identity (such as a birth certificate or passport), evidence of residency (such as an utility bill), and a legitimate Social Security Number or Taxpayer Identification Number. Additional documents may be required depending on your state's guidelines.

Q: How long is a driver's authorization valid?

  • A: The credibility period of a driver's permit differs by state but is normally in between 6 months and 2 years. Some states may allow you to renew your authorization if you need more time to get ready for the driving test.

Q: Can I drive alone with a learner's license?

  • A: No, you must constantly be accompanied by a certified driver who is at least 21 years of ages while holding a student's license. This is to guarantee your safety and the security of others on the roadway.

Q: What takes place if I fail the composed authorization test?

  • A: If you stop working the written authorization test, you can normally retake it after a particular period, such as 1 to 3 days, depending on your state's rules. There might be a fee for retaking the test.

Q: How can I get ready for the vision test?

  • A: Ensure that your vision is clear by using your glasses or contact lenses if you need them. The vision test is typically a basic procedure, and as long as your vision fulfills the minimum requirements, you ought to pass.

Q: Can I practice driving on highways with a student's license?

  • A: It is normally not recommended to practice on highways till you have more experience and are more detailed to taking the driving test. A lot of states have constraints on where authorization holders can drive, which might consist of avoiding highways.

Q: What are the next actions after acquiring a learner's authorization?

  • A: After acquiring a student's permit, concentrate on getting monitored driving experience. Keep a log of your practice hours, and when you have fulfilled the needed variety of hours, you can arrange the driving test to get a full driver's license.
